In my ongoing PyTorch journey, I know I will want to visualize neural networks that I study.
Which tool to use?
Manim, which is used by the famous YouTube Channel 3Blue1Brown, would be great for this.
BUT, I have a ton more experience doing such things with Visual Python, and it's intuitive to this "physics and data based" modeler.
So, I put together this initial Python class for a starting point.
I am eager to add dynamic indicators for weight changes during training and indicators on the neurons of activation values and such.
If you want to follow the repo for this, it's here → Neural_Net_Visualizer.
Clone the repo, and I hope to be making updates to it ASAP.
I've attempted to make a simple input scheme to keep this tool extremely flexible.
